Ai control refers to the measures, strategies, and frameworks designed to regulate the development, deployment, and functioning of ai systems. as ai evolves, its capabilities expand, raising concerns about its impact on society, human rights, job markets, and ethical standards. Ai alignment is the technical process of encoding goals and, with them, human values into ai models to make them reliable, safe and, ultimately, helpful. there are at least two important challenges to consider. Nick bostrom, a philosopher at the university of oxford, proposed a thought experiment in 2003 to explain the control problem of aligning a superintelligent ai. in this experiment, an intelligence greater than human intelligence is tasked with making as many paperclips as possible.
